Culinary Competition (May, 2025 )

Introduction:

In celebration of cultural diversity and global understanding, Fakeeh College for Medical Sciences (FCMS) hosted the International Culinary Competition on May 15, 2025. This event aimed to showcase students’ talents in culinary arts while deepening their appreciation for international cultures. By preparing traditional dishes from around the world, students engaged in a vibrant and flavorful journey that combined creativity, teamwork, and cultural exploration. The event highlighted FCMS's commitment to promoting inclusivity and experiential learning beyond the classroom.

Brief description of the activity:

  • The event featured booths representing six countries: Lebanon, Morocco, Italy, Japan, America, and Mexico.
  • Participating students chose one traditional dish to prepare and present for each country.
  • Dishes were judged based on taste, authenticity, presentation, and cultural explanation using a standardized rubric.
  • Winners were awarded cash prizes, shared equally among group members.
  • The atmosphere was festive, educational, and inclusive, with vibrant decorations and diverse aromas adding to the experience.
